Wireless Adapter (as required) MON May 16 HEAT FAN AUTO NIGHT MENU MON May 16 11:23a 67 F HEAT FAN AUTO NIGHT ° 63 MENU Zone 1 11:23a 67 F ° 63 Additional Zones Wireless Area Controller Ethernet/IP Additional Areas and Buildings ControlScope Manager System Controller 5 Quality Control: LG LED Lighting Leads the Way Quality control was a particular area of the LED lighting industry where LG saw perhaps the greatest opportunity for improvement. Malfunctioning or just plain broken products are not merely inconvenient, they waste installers’ precious time in the field. LG LED uses advanced testing labs and equipment to ensure the reliability of all our products, through delivery, installation and years of dependable performance. We don’t merely sample test, we light up and run photometric analysis on 100% of our troffers, in addition to a 30-minute “burn-in” test. Our packaging is even designed to withstand a five-foot drop. And our published specifications are based on actual delivered lumens, not the LED module ratings. So upgrading to the value, performance and style of LG LED Lighting has never been a more attractive proposition for property owners, with full payback often in less than two years. 7 Long Life Average Lumen Maintenance 105.0 Ts 55°C Ts 85°C 100.0 95.0 % 90.0 85.0 There is a lot of misinformation in the marketplace regarding the lifespan of LED lighting. The LG LM-80 Test projects that our technology will maintain 70% illuminance for more than 200,000 hours. According to U.S. Generally Accepted Accounting Principles 80.0 (fasb.org), that’s longer than the useful life of a commercial 0 1000 2000 3000 4000 5000 6000 7000 8000 9000 office building (39 years) that’s open for business from 8 am to 6 pm, Monday through Friday! [PROJECT DETAILS] Project Name owner NB|AZ Bisbee Branch National Bank of Arizona Location additional team members Bisbee, AZ LG LED Lighting Agent Wild West Lighting, working with Gamble Electric Product 48W, 4400lm, 4000K 2' x 4' Recessed Troffers 30W, 2100lm, 4000K Commercial Downlights National Bank of Arizona (NB|AZ) provides individuals and businesses with a variety of banking and financial services at approximately 70 branches throughout the state, boasting more than $4.5 billion in assets. NB|AZ needed an energy-efficient lighting solution for their new branch locations that would also provide a bright and modern look, as well as a way to replace their existing incandescent fixtures with more efficient LED technology. They also sought to improve upon their high-maintenance fluorescent fixtures, which were plagued by ballast burnouts, along with the need to re-lamp every two years. NB|AZ installed a combination of 2' x 4' LED Troffers and commercial downlights from LG Electronics. Greater efficiency was achieved by switching from 96W T8 fluorescent to 48W LED fixtures, resulting in a 50% reduction in energy consumption. Thanks to the lighting installation at the Bisbee branch, for example, NB|AZ stands to save more than 50% versus fluorescent lighting, while virtually eliminating maintenance spends on lightingrelated items for the next five to seven years. LG Electronics leads by example, cutting costs and saving energy with their office-wide lighting upgrade. The old lighting offered employees a mere 20–35 footcandles of luminance, but the new higher-efficiency LED lights deliver 50–65 footcandles. At a total cost of $215K, this project earned LG a NJ Smart Star rebate of more than $42K, in addition to an EPACT tax deduction of another $14K. Energy savings factor out to more than $42K annually, while reduced maintenance costs provide a further $12K in savings each year. With these impressive figures, LG is on track for simple payback in less than three years. What’s more, based on 5% capitalization, this project has increased the value of the building by $842K.
